Description
When you are using definition list plugin, if you want to use a colon in the definition, there is no way to do this that I know of because the colon is used to separate the term from the definition. If you have a second colon on the line, the second colon and everything after it is cut off (not displayed).
Solution

To keeps things constant, I have added a ~colon~ literal. Here is the patch:

patch
Copy to clipboard
diff --git a/lib/core/JisonParser/Wiki/HtmlCharacter.php b/lib/core/JisonParser/Wiki/HtmlCharacter.php index 54a8f14..b2d2784 100644 --- a/lib/core/JisonParser/Wiki/HtmlCharacter.php +++ b/lib/core/JisonParser/Wiki/HtmlCharacter.php @@ -22,6 +22,7 @@ class JisonParser_Wiki_HtmlCharacter 'lt' => array('exp' => '/~lt~/i', 'output' => '&lt;'), 'gt' => array('exp' => '/~gt~/i', 'output' => '&gt;'), 'rm' => array('exp' => '/[{]rm[}]/i','output' => '&rlm;'), + ':' => array('exp' => '/~colon~/', 'output' => ':'), // HTML numeric character entities 'num' => array('exp' => '/~([0-9]+)~/','output' =>'&#$1;'), ); diff --git a/lib/parser/parserlib.php b/lib/parser/parserlib.php index adc03ef..bf737e9 100644 --- a/lib/parser/parserlib.php +++ b/lib/parser/parserlib.php @@ -164,6 +164,7 @@ class ParserLib extends TikiDb_Bridge $data = preg_replace("/ -- /", " &mdash; ", $data); $data = preg_replace("/~lt~/i", "&lt;", $data); $data = preg_replace("/~gt~/i", "&gt;", $data); + $data = preg_replace("/~colon~/", ":", $data); // HTML numeric character entities $data = preg_replace("/~([0-9]+)~/", "&#$1;", $data); diff --git a/lib/test/core/JisonParser/OutputTest.php b/lib/test/core/JisonParser/OutputTest.php index cdcb4ab..9460b5d 100644 --- a/lib/test/core/JisonParser/OutputTest.php +++ b/lib/test/core/JisonParser/OutputTest.php @@ -125,6 +125,7 @@ class JisonParser_OutputTest extends JisonParser_Abstract 'dash2' => array(' -- ', ' &mdash; '), 'lt' => array('~lt~', '&lt;'), 'gt' => array('~gt~', '&gt;'), + 'colon' => array('~colon~', ':'), //$content = preg_replace("/~([0-9]+)~/", "&#$1;", $content); //block level syntax diff --git a/templates/tiki-edit_help.tpl b/templates/tiki-edit_help.tpl index 806309f..99b767e 100644 --- a/templates/tiki-edit_help.tpl +++ b/templates/tiki-edit_help.tpl @@ -96,6 +96,7 @@ {literal}~rsq~{/literal} &rsquo;, {literal}~--~{/literal} &mdash;, {literal}~bs~{/literal} \, +{literal}~colon~{/literal} :, {tr}numeric between ~ for HTML numeric characters entity{/tr}</td></tr> </table>
